Photography Exhibit by Tom Hausler

Nature and Wildlife Photographer

(Currently on Display at the Warren Skaaren Environmental Learning Center)

Capturing wildlife in their own habitat and beautiful landscapes is challenging but rewarding. When I am in the field it's about the thrill of the chase and can't wait to capture the next image.

Over the last few years I have photographed and volunteered at Westcave Preserve, and at the same time had the opportunity to travel to many wonderful places.   Westcave is still my favorite place to visit and photograph.

Just returned from a trip to Norway, one of the most beautiful places in the world.   Snow was melting and water was flowing in all the rivers and waterfalls.
